Springtime Splendor (April – May)
Spring awakens the Sea to Sky region with a vibrant tapestry of colors. As the snow melts, wildflowers begin to bloom, painting the alpine meadows in a riot of hues. The air is crisp and fresh, and the waterfalls cascade with renewed vigor.
Hiking and Wildflower Viewing
Spring is an ideal time for hiking enthusiasts to explore the gondola’s network of trails. The lower elevation trails are often accessible earlier in the season, offering breathtaking views of the surrounding mountains and valleys. Keep an eye out for wildflowers like lupines, trilliums, and paintbrush, adding a splash of color to the landscape.
Birdwatching Paradise
Spring marks the return of migratory birds to the region. Keep your binoculars handy as you might spot eagles, hawks, hummingbirds, and various songbirds. The gondola’s summit offers a prime vantage point for birdwatching.
Pleasant Temperatures
Spring days are generally mild, with temperatures ranging from 10 to 15 degrees Celsius. However, evenings can be cool, so pack layers of clothing.
Summertime Adventures (June – August)
Summer in the Sea to Sky region is a time for adventure and outdoor exploration. The days are long and sunny, perfect for hiking, biking, and enjoying the vibrant alpine atmosphere.
Hiking and Mountain Biking
The gondola’s summit offers access to a network of challenging and rewarding hiking trails. Experienced hikers can tackle the summit ridge trail, while those seeking a more leisurely experience can opt for the scenic Sky Pilot Trail. Summit Dining and Events
Enjoy breathtaking views while savoring delicious meals at the Summit Lodge restaurant. The gondola also hosts various summer events, including live music, yoga classes, and stargazing nights.
Warm and Sunny Weather
Summer days are warm and sunny, with temperatures often reaching into the 20s Celsius. However, evenings can be cool, so pack layers of clothing.
Autumnal Hues (September – October)
Autumn transforms the Sea to Sky region into a painter’s palette of vibrant colors. The aspen trees shimmer in shades of gold and crimson, while the surrounding mountains are cloaked in a tapestry of warm hues.
Foliage Viewing and Photography
The gondola offers stunning panoramic views of the autumn foliage. Capture the breathtaking beauty of the changing leaves with your camera. The lower elevation trails are also ideal for leisurely walks amidst the colorful foliage.
Crisp and Cool Air
Autumn days are crisp and cool, with temperatures ranging from 10 to 15 degrees Celsius. Evenings can be chilly, so pack warm layers of clothing.
Winter Wonderland (November – March)
Winter blankets the Sea to Sky region in a pristine layer of snow, creating a magical winter wonderland. The gondola offers breathtaking views of snow-capped mountains and frozen lakes. (See Also: Best Time To Visit Magic Mountain – Thrill Seeker’s Guide)
Snowshoeing and Cross-Country Skiing
The gondola’s summit provides access to groomed snowshoeing and cross-country skiing trails. Enjoy the tranquility of the snow-covered landscape and the invigorating exercise.
Winter Festivals and Events
The Sea to Sky region hosts various winter festivals and events, including ice sculptures, snowshoeing races, and holiday markets.
Snowy and Cold Weather
Winter days are cold and snowy, with temperatures often below freezing. Dress warmly in layers and be prepared for icy conditions.

Is there accessibility for people with disabilities?
The Sea to Sky Gondola is committed to accessibility. The gondola cabins are wheelchair accessible, and there are accessible pathways and restrooms at both the base and summit terminals. For specific accessibility information, it’s best to contact the gondola directly.
What should I wear when visiting the Sea to Sky Gondola?
Dress in layers, as the weather can change quickly in the mountains. Comfortable walking shoes are essential, especially if you plan to hike. A hat, sunglasses, and sunscreen are recommended for sunny days. During colder months, pack warm clothing, including a hat, gloves, and a scarf.
